Dietary management of low plasma or low red blood cell folate in certain patients. It may also be used for other conditions as determined by your doctor.
DuLeek-Dp is a medical food. It works by providing the body with folate.

Store DuLeek-Dp at room temperature, between 59 and 86 degrees F (15 and 30 degrees C). Store in original container until just before use. Store away from heat, light, and moisture. Do not store in the bathroom. Keep DuLeek-Dp out of the reach of children and away from pets.
